Through the lens of the surreal and the mundane, author Anthony Wong explores what it means to be alone - and in the process, what it means to change.
Written at the height of the COVID-19 pandemic, A Shape and a Run is a collection of short stories centered around the concept of isolation: its origins, manifestations, and effects on people. Wong artfully taps into the often debilitating emotions that spring from within this shared state of loneliness. Though feelings of apathy and grief may have gained hold of the public consciousness, this book charts the ability to ultimately shift one’s mind from hopelessness to hopefulness.
In this turbulent world we’re living in, Anthony Wong’s A Shape and a Run strives to reaffirm a sense of agency that the times seem to have taken away. It emphasizes how even if one is alone, or feeling alone, they can find solace in the things in life that still make it worth living
